Rail Corridor Study
THE OBJECTIVES OF THIS RAIL LINE CORRIDOR STUDY ARE AS FOLLOWS:
IDENTIFY THE OPTIMAL RAIL LINE CORRIDOR WITHIN YUMA COUNTY THAT WOULD CONNECT TO THE UNION PACIFIC SUNSET ROUTE MAIN LINE ON THE NORTH AND POTENTIALLY TO THE FERROMEX RAIL LINE RUNNING BETWEEN HERMOSILLO AND MEXICALI ON THE SOUTH
THE IDENTIFIED RAIL LINE CORRIDOR IS INTENDED TO ENABLE THE LOCAL GOVERNMENTS TO PRESERVE THE NEEDED RIGHT OF WAY FOR THE RAIL LINE TO BE CONSTRUCTED IN THE FUTURE WHEN WARRANTED
DETERMINE THE LOCATION AND FACILITY REQUIREMENTS FOR THE RAIL LINE CROSSING OF THE INTERNATIONAL BORDER WITH TENTATIVE APPROVAL OF THE FEDERAL AND LOCAL AND FOREIGN AGENCIES
Rail Corridor Study
Study Area The study area is approximately bounded as
follows:On the west by the Arizona State LineOn the north by the Union Pacific Sunset
Route main lineOn the east by South Fortuna Road and its
extensionOn the south by the Ferromex rail line
STUDY OBJECTIVESDetermine a desirable border crossing
location that accommodates future commodity flows.
Recommend a feasible rail corridor in Yuma County between Mexico and Arizona.
Conduct public involvement activities to promote and solicit public input.
Identify short term freight related economic development that can be expanded to meet long term needs.
